WebTake the humble carbon atom as an example: in most organic molecules a covalently-bonded carbon atom is around 1.5 Ångstroms in diameter (1 Ångstrom unit = 0.1 nanometres = 10 -10 metres); but the same atom in an ionic crystal appears much smaller: around 0.6 Ångstroms. During the chromatographic experiment, a … small food webWebWe know the hydrated radius is defined as the radius of ions and closely bonded water molecules. This means that the hydrated radius is the radius of ions when surrounded by water molecules.
